Project Management by the book

This course integrates the globally recognized project management standards of the Project Management Institute (PMI®) and the PMBOK® Guide with the timeless wisdom of Scripture. Students learn to initiate, plan, execute, monitor, and close projects with excellence, integrity, and servant leadership. Each module pairs a biblical narrative (e.g., Nehemiah’s wall, Noah’s ark, Moses at the burning bush, Jesus washing feet) with a secular corporate case study (e.g., NASA’s Apollo program, the Panama Canal, Toyota Production System, Johnson & Johnson crisis). The Bible serves not as a devotional supplement but as the original source of project management principles—covering scope definition, stakeholder engagement, risk management, ethical decision‑making, and lessons learned. Students complete a final project: a full Project Management Plan for a real or hypothetical faith‑based or non‑profit initiative. This course is designed for business professionals, ministry leaders, and students seeking PMP® certification or advanced leadership skills with a biblical foundation.
